<block wx:for-items="{{item.pages}}" wx:for-item="page" wx:key="*item"> 然后,用wx:for-items,对list里面的pages属性内嵌数组做了遍历循环,注意,后面又立即跟了wx:for-item="page",注意,这里没有s,就是对item的元素pages数组的元素重新命名为page了,后面的page操作,就是对这个内嵌数组操作。这里wx...
wx:for等价与wx:for-items是循环数组用的;而wx:for-item则是给列表赋别名用的
<block wx:for-items="{{grids}}" wx:key="*this"> <block wx:for="{{grids}}" wx:key="*this"> <navigator url="" class="weui-grid" hover-class="weui-grid_active"> <image class="weui-grid__icon" src="../images/icon_tabbar.png" /> <view class="weui-grid__label">Grid</view...
【案】笔者认为wx:for-items应该可以包容wx:for,⽽不是像有些朋友说,wx:for⽤于数组的单循环,⽽wx:for-items⽤于可嵌套的多级循环。很显然,wx:for-items,在上⾯的例⼦⾥⾯⽤于数组,也同时⽤于外层的单循环。【案】<view wx:for-items="{{array}}" wx:for-item="item"> 分析⼀...
运行效果 ps:wx:for等价与wx:for-items 是循环数组用的;而wx:for-item 则是给列表赋别名用的。
微信⼩程序wx:for、wx:for-items和wx:for-item的正确⽤法 wx:for = "{{list}}" ⽤来循环数组 如果是⼀维数组,实例:1. <view wx:for="{{list}}"> 2. {{index}} {{item.name}} 3. </view> 以上代码中item即为list的别名。如果是⼆维或多维数组:1. <view wx:for="{{p...
wx:for 主要用于循环输出数组,对象等; wx:key 主要用于在动态生成的列表当中,保持一些栏位的状态不变;官方的解释是:如果列表中项目的位置会动态改变或者有新的项目添...
1 wx:for 从目前的例子看,wx:for 的使用确实是对数组来做的,参考微信icon示例程序。 示例里面都是对数组进行条件判断,比如iconsizejius就是一个典型的数组。 2 wx:for-items 与wx:for-item 2.1 wx:for-items 现在看wx:for-items, 和wx:for比,wx:for-items有什么不同呢? 【案】笔者认为wx:for-items应...
微信小程序wx:for-items里面的js操作 呆头呆脑 14124467 发布于 2018-01-16 现在的要求是一个列表三种显示方式,但是有一种显示方式如果字数过长,会看不见字所以想要截取前几个字代码写得类似写在wx:for-items循环里面 <text> {{list.name.length>7?(list.name.substr(0,5)):list.name}}...
wx:key 主要用于在动态生成的列表当中,保持一些栏位的状态不变; 官方的解释是: 如果列表中项目的位置会动态改变或者有新的项目添加到列表中,并且希望列表中的项目保持自己的特征和状态(如 中的输入内容, 的选中状态),需要使用 wx:key 来指定列表中项目的唯一的标识符。